Retail Theft
7621 N State Road 7 - CVS
On June 10, two unknown males entered the store and selected 11 Rogaine Hair products valued at $599.39 and left the store without paying for the merchandise.

Theft
9330 Noor Blvd - Four Seasons
On June 10, 4 overnight theft of a 2014 Kabota RTV-X900 utility vehicle from the job site, unknown subject. No video.
10793 Aqua Ct/Lago Way - Cascata
On June 10, 2012, John Deere 4x2 utility vehicle removed from the construction site during the night by an unknown subject. The vehicle is GPS equipped but the last recorded location was Homestead FL early this morning. No video in use, possibly related to above in which a Kabota utility vehicle was stolen nearby at the same time.
